| Job Position | Company | Posted | Location | Salary | Tags |
|---|---|---|---|---|---|
dydx | New York, NY, United States | $130k - $275k | |||
dmarket | Ukraine | $84k - $90k | |||
dmarket | Remote | $84k - $90k | |||
clearmatics | Remote | $62k - $77k | |||
| Learn job-ready web3 skills on your schedule with 1-on-1 support & get a job, or your money back. | | by Metana Bootcamp Info | |||
chainsafesystems | Remote | $105k - $150k | |||
chainsafesystems | Remote | $84k - $84k | |||
Blockdaemon | EMEA | $200k | |||
Blockdaemon | Singapore, Singapore | $76k - $81k | |||
BitMEX | Hong Kong, Hong Kong | $90k - $150k | |||
Ava Labs Ecosystem | Remote | $123k - $154k | |||
Ava Labs Ecosystem | Remote | $142k - $178k | |||
Ava Labs Ecosystem | Remote | $142k - $178k | |||
Ava Labs | Remote | $142k - $178k | |||
Ava Labs | Remote | $105k - $110k | |||
Ava Labs | Remote | $142k - $178k |
Senior Software Engineer/Protocol – dYdX Trading (New York, NY): Design and implement core components for the dYdX Version 4 decentralized trading platform, including the assets, epoch, transfer, accounts, reward vesting and funding modules using the Cosmos SDK blockchain framework and Golang programming language. Use Datadog to analyze and set up alerts for the performance of these modules. Additional duties include: maintain Testnet stability by implementing fixes of critical production issues and being actively on-call for network alerts; design and implement the decentralized startup process of dYdX Version 4 Testnets involving 60+ validator organizations across the world; research IBC (open-source Inter-Blockchain Communication Protocol) to exchange information between blockchains, and design/implement the cross-chain integration between dYdX Version 4 Blockchain and other networks in the Cosmos ecosystem, using the Golang programming language; research academic papers on consensus algorithms and make updates to dYdX-maintained fork of CometBFT (open-source consensus engine) to improve reliability of the dYdX Version 4 blockchain; mentor and train junior software engineers on blockchain technologies and dYdX specific blockchain architectures; and ensure engineering best practices within the teams through guidance on code reviews, testing, efficiency, and other engineering excellence improvements. Requires a Bachelor’s degree in Computer Science or a related field and 5 years of software development experience, including at least 2 years of experience with Cosmos SDK framework, CometBFT (Byzantine Fault Tolerant consensus engine), IBC (Inter-Blockchain Communication Protocol), Datadog (monitoring and analytics tool), and the Golang and TypeScript programming languages. Apply online at https://dydx.exchange/careers The pay range for this role in New York City is $130,000 to $275,000
What does a Golang developer in web3 do?
A Golang (Go) developer who works in the web3 space likely focuses on creating and implementing decentralized applications (DApps) using Go and the web3 stack
This stack typically includes technologies like blockchain, smart contracts, and distributed systems
Go is a popular programming language for developing web3 applications because of its simplicity, performance, and support for concurrent programming
The specific tasks and responsibilities of a Golang developer in the web3 space may vary depending on the project and organization they are working for.